We had a virus alert going around. They've wrote up a whole explanation how the virus sends you an email making it look like a response from Canada Revenue Agency response to some claim that YOUR EMPLOYER filed (they even manage to get your employer's name somehow....). The email you get even has a pretty Canadian flag logo and everything and it prompts you to click on the link provided (which leads you to some obscure blog.... which is rather odd for CRA to do) and that's how you'd get the virus.
Now, the email everyone got explained that everyone should be aware of this threat and directed everyone to the attached virus email with link being disabled. NOT!
Yeah, they forgot to remove the link. Wonder how many curious geniuses actually clicked... We had two followups saying that we shouldn't click the link since it was left active....
